Abstract(in English) There is a topographic connection between the cortical primary visual cortex and the retina, called the retinal map. This suggests that the retinal image can be estimated from the response pattern of the primary visual cortex to visual stimuli. In this study, we analyzed the relationship between the spatiotemporal patterns of visual stimuli and the responses of the primary visual cortex measured by Intrinsic Optical Signal (IOS) imaging in awake mice. The results showed that depending on the structure of the visual stimulus, there was no simple topographic relationship between the spatial patterns of visual cortex responses. This suggests that, in principle, it is difficult to estimate retinal images from cortical IOS in mice.
